Cashie River

 
 
 

Bertie County and Town of Windsor officials continue to coordinate with NC Emergency Management staff to compile damage assessment estimates for impacted areas countywide and the Town of Windsor, in order to determine the level of State financial assistance available for residents and business impacted by last week’s flooding.

 Immediate assistance for unmet needs such as replacement of medication, lost dentures, food and short term housing is available through the Red Cross, which has staff at the Department of Social Services building and is located at 110 Jasper Avenue.  Red Cross services will continue through Wednesday, Thursday, Friday, Saturday and Sunday of this week.

 

For immediate assistance with clean-up, muck-out, removal of soiled carpet, wet drywall and soggy insulation or duct work removal, residents are encouraged to visit:

  • The United Methodist Disaster Relief application center at the NC mobile disaster recovery center located at the rear parking lot of the County’s Department of Social Services building at 110 Jasper Avenue.

  • The North Carolina Baptist Men are taking applications to assist residents with flood damage clean-up and are located at the Cashie Baptist Church at 221 South Queen Street in Windsor.

  • Disaster hotline for information is available at 252-794-5320.

 

Additional information regarding the availability of specific financial assistance will be forthcoming.

 

Citizens whose residences were not impacted are encouraged to check on their family members, friends and neighbors who may need a helping hand or someone to run errands for them.  Please consider what your church, civic organization or individual citizen can do to support their community at this critical time of stress and concern for the people impacted by this flooding.
